Bonus Math

Understanding the numbers behind bonuses helps you make informed decisions. Consider a typical welcome bonus: a 100% match up to $500 with a wagering requirement of 30x the bonus amount, maximum bet $5 during wagering, and slot games contributing 100% while table games contribute only 10%.

Important: Always verify the exact terms on the site, as these figures vary.

Step 1: Calculate the total wagering requirement.
Wagering Requirement = Bonus Amount × Wagering Multiplier
Bonus Amount = $500 (assuming you deposit $500 to get the full match)
Wagering Multiplier = 30×
Total Wagering = $500 × 30 = $15,000

Step 2: Estimate expected loss based on game RTP.
If you play a slot with a Return to Player (RTP) of 96%, the house edge is 4%.
Expected Loss = Total Wagering × (1 – RTP)
Expected Loss = $15,000 × 0.04 = $600

Step 3: Compare the expected loss with the bonus value.
You receive $500 in bonus funds, but the mathematical expectation is to lose $600 during wagering, resulting in a net loss of $100. This does not mean you will definitely lose—it only reflects the average outcome over many players. Variance can lead to wins, but the house edge favors the casino.

Step 4: Optimize your play.
Select games with the highest RTP (typically 97% or more) to reduce expected loss. For example, a slot with 97% RTP gives an expected loss of $15,000 × 0.03 = $450, making the bonus closer to break-even.

Need to Know

How long does a typical withdrawal take?

E-wallet withdrawals are usually processed within 24 hours, credit cards take 2–5 business days, and bank transfers can take up to a week. Cryptocurrency depends on network confirmations.

What documents are required for KYC?

A government-issued photo ID (passport or driver’s license), a recent utility bill or bank statement for address verification, and sometimes a selfie holding the ID.

Is the casino licensed?

The platform operates under a Curacao eGaming license. This provides basic oversight but does not offer the same protections as a UK or Maltese license.

How do I claim the welcome bonus?

Usually, you opt in during registration or make a qualifying deposit of at least the minimum amount (e.g., $20). Some bonuses require a bonus code. Check the promotions page for details.

Which games contribute to wagering requirements?

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games (blackjack, roulette) contribute only 10% or even 0%. Live dealer games often contribute a lower percentage. Always read the bonus terms.

What is the maximum bet during wagering?

Most casinos enforce a maximum bet of $5 or €5 per spin/hand while the bonus is active. Exceeding this can void the bonus and any winnings.
